Visual studio code Can';t在VS代码中终止Linux上运行的任务

Visual studio code Can';t在VS代码中终止Linux上运行的任务,visual-studio-code,Visual Studio Code,我无法终止在Linux上运行的任务。我正在使用npm run来执行我的构建脚本,该脚本将启动webpack dev服务器。这会一直运行,直到我手动停止它,这在Windows上可以正常工作,但在Linux上我只会收到错误“无法终止正在运行的任务” 发生这种情况时,没有信息打印到控制台。有人有什么建议吗?有没有办法获得更多关于此失败原因的信息?嗯,我发现了问题所在。terminateProcess.sh没有可执行权限。实际上,代码可执行文件或任何其他sh文件都没有。我不理解为什么解压时它们还不能执行

我无法终止在Linux上运行的任务。我正在使用npm run来执行我的构建脚本,该脚本将启动webpack dev服务器。这会一直运行,直到我手动停止它,这在Windows上可以正常工作,但在Linux上我只会收到错误“无法终止正在运行的任务”


发生这种情况时,没有信息打印到控制台。有人有什么建议吗?有没有办法获得更多关于此失败原因的信息?

嗯,我发现了问题所在。terminateProcess.sh没有可执行权限。实际上,代码可执行文件或任何其他sh文件都没有。我不理解为什么解压时它们还不能执行,但一旦我提供了许可,它就解决了这个问题。

您的问题是如何终止任务,还是如何获取任务失败的信息?我认为这有点不清楚?理想情况下,有人已经知道它失败的原因,并告诉我如何解决它。如果没有,有关如何获取失败原因的信息的一些指导将很有帮助。可能您对运行代码的进程没有管理员权限。如果我以root用户身份运行,这种情况仍然会发生。您可以将此答案标记为社区Wiki的答案吗?